Output 20d12c564c1908abe227232b3e6b8647c353f838af822bd72532aa6faacf76d4:81

value
202655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d83926cf1ca48f70c7d76315bf6190643801784 OP_EQUAL
address
37JGm2VMy5SR28FWdXCvk1YmLdcbx33BZt
transaction
20d12c564c1908abe227232b3e6b8647c353f838af822bd72532aa6faacf76d4
confirmations
156525
spent
true